Any D-Series engine is compatible. My CX Started life as a Factory D15B8. Now it's a B8 Block with 4 Valve relief pistons, a 2000 D16Y8 Head and a 1995 D16Z6 Intake with a 2000 EX Transmission.

It depends on the model. D16Y8 Honda Civic EX 1996-2000 D15Z Honda Civic HF 1996-2000 D15Y7 Honda Civic DX/LX/CX 1996-2000

The horn relay is mounted underneath the dashboard on the 1995 Honda Civic. The unit is mounted on the upper right of the cabin fuse box.
